Gal Gadot’s 2020 film, Wonder Woman 1984 was the best-selling home media movie of 2021.
The release history behind Gal Gadot’s Wonder Woman 1984 is a bit of a complicated one. Like many other films, it was delayed throughout 2020 due to concerns over the Covid-19 pandemic. Eventually, it became the first film that Warner Bros would release in theaters and on HBO Max simultaneously.
Ultimitly Wonder Woman 1984 would only gross a little over $166M worldwide on a reported $200M budget. It was, however, a big hit on HBO Max and saw the new streaming service get a big boost in subscribers. Now it appears that the home media success continued throughout 2021.
According to The Numbers, Gal Gadot’s Wonder Woman 1984 was the best-selling home media movie of 2021. Between the Blu-Ray and DVD sales, the film sold well over 1.4M copies worldwide. The next highest-selling film was The Croods: A New Age but was beaten by roughly 200K copies.
